package_managers.py•5.12 kB
"""Package manager abstraction for cross-platform dependency installation.""" from abc import ABC, abstractmethod from typing import List, Tuple import subprocess import shutil import logging logger = logging.getLogger(__name__) class PackageManager(ABC): """Base class for package managers.""" @abstractmethod def check_available(self) -> bool: """Check if this package manager is available.""" pass @abstractmethod def check_package(self, package_name: str) -> bool: """Check if a package is installed.""" pass @abstractmethod def install_packages(self, package_names: List[str], verbose: bool = False) -> Tuple[bool, str]: """Install packages. Returns (success, message).""" pass class BrewManager(PackageManager): """Homebrew package manager (macOS).""" def check_available(self) -> bool: return shutil.which("brew") is not None def check_package(self, package_name: str) -> bool: try: result = subprocess.run( ["brew", "list", package_name], capture_output=True, text=True, timeout=5 ) return result.returncode == 0 except (subprocess.SubprocessError, OSError) as e: logger.debug(f"Error checking package {package_name}: {e}") return False def install_packages(self, package_names: List[str], verbose: bool = False) -> Tuple[bool, str]: cmd = ["brew", "install"] + package_names try: if verbose: result = subprocess.run(cmd, text=True, timeout=300) return result.returncode == 0, "" else: result = subprocess.run(cmd, capture_output=True, text=True, timeout=300) return result.returncode == 0, result.stderr or result.stdout except (subprocess.SubprocessError, OSError) as e: return False, str(e) class AptManager(PackageManager): """APT package manager (Debian/Ubuntu).""" def check_available(self) -> bool: return shutil.which("apt-get") is not None def check_package(self, package_name: str) -> bool: try: result = subprocess.run( ["dpkg", "-l", package_name], capture_output=True, text=True, timeout=5 ) return result.returncode == 0 and "ii" in result.stdout except (subprocess.SubprocessError, OSError) as e: logger.debug(f"Error checking package {package_name}: {e}") return False def install_packages(self, package_names: List[str], verbose: bool = False) -> Tuple[bool, str]: # Need sudo for apt cmd = ["sudo", "apt-get", "install", "-y"] + package_names try: if verbose: result = subprocess.run(cmd, text=True, timeout=600) return result.returncode == 0, "" else: result = subprocess.run(cmd, capture_output=True, text=True, timeout=600) return result.returncode == 0, result.stderr or result.stdout except (subprocess.SubprocessError, OSError) as e: return False, str(e) class DnfManager(PackageManager): """DNF package manager (Fedora/RHEL).""" def check_available(self) -> bool: return shutil.which("dnf") is not None def check_package(self, package_name: str) -> bool: try: result = subprocess.run( ["rpm", "-q", package_name], capture_output=True, text=True, timeout=5 ) return result.returncode == 0 except (subprocess.SubprocessError, OSError) as e: logger.debug(f"Error checking package {package_name}: {e}") return False def install_packages(self, package_names: List[str], verbose: bool = False) -> Tuple[bool, str]: # Need sudo for dnf cmd = ["sudo", "dnf", "install", "-y"] + package_names try: if verbose: result = subprocess.run(cmd, text=True, timeout=600) return result.returncode == 0, "" else: result = subprocess.run(cmd, capture_output=True, text=True, timeout=600) return result.returncode == 0, result.stderr or result.stdout except (subprocess.SubprocessError, OSError) as e: return False, str(e) def get_package_manager() -> PackageManager: """Detect and return appropriate package manager for current platform. Returns: PackageManager: The detected package manager instance Raises: RuntimeError: If no supported package manager is found """ managers = [BrewManager(), DnfManager(), AptManager()] for manager in managers: if manager.check_available(): logger.debug(f"Detected package manager: {manager.__class__.__name__}") return manager raise RuntimeError("No supported package manager found (tried brew, dnf, apt-get)")
